Oco Out To Map the Business Genome (AMR)

Since the late 1980s, Mr. O’Conor has been consumed with getting clean data out of existing systems without having to replace everything with a single monolithic application suite. In 1999, he started Oco to solve this problem. He spent five years developing his software. Today, he is one of the first providers of “On Demand Data Integration” and “On Demand Analytics.”
